resin; resina

Description:

broad term used to indicate organic substances that are usually translucent or transparent and are soluble in ether, acetone, and similar substances but not in water. They are named according to their chemical composition, physical structure, and means for activation or curing. Examples are acrylic resin, autopolymer resin (cold-curing resin), synthetic resin, styrene resin, and vinyl resin.
